List of Important Days in April 2025
Below is a detailed list of important days in April including with National Days, International Days, and Festivals:
Date | Occasion/Observation | Description |
---|---|---|
April 1 | Orissa Day | Marks the formation of the state of Odisha (formerly Orissa) on April 1, 1936. |
April 1 | Prevention of Blindness Week | Focuses on raising awareness about preventing blindness and promoting eye health. |
April 1 | April Fools’ Day | A day for playing pranks and jokes, celebrated globally as a day of humor and mischief. |
April 2 | World Autism Awareness Day | Raises awareness about autism and promotes acceptance and inclusion of people with autism. |
April 4 | International Day for Mine Awareness | Focuses on raising awareness of land mines and advocating for mine-free communities. |
April 5 | National Maritime Day (India) | Commemorates the launch of India’s first ship, SS Loyalty, in 1919 and highlights the maritime industry. |
April 7 | World Health Day | Celebrates the founding of the World Health Organization and raises awareness about global health issues. |
April 10 | National Homeopathy Day (India) | Celebrates the birth anniversary of Dr. Samuel Hahnemann, the founder of homeopathy, and promotes the benefits of this medical practice. |
April 10 | National Siblings Day (USA) | Celebrates the bond between siblings, honoring their role in our lives and fostering family connection. |
April 10 | National Pet Day (USA) | Celebrates the joy and companionship pets bring to people’s lives. |
April 11 | National Safe Motherhood Day (India) | Focuses on reducing maternal mortality rates and promoting safer maternity care. |
April 11 | National Pet Day (USA) | Celebrates the joy and companionship pets bring to people’s lives. |
April 12 | Yuri’s Night (World Space Party) | Celebrates human spaceflight, marking the first manned space flight by Yuri Gagarin. |
April 12 | International Day of Human Space Flight | Commemorates the first human spaceflight by Yuri Gagarin on April 12, 1961, celebrating space exploration. |
April 14 | Baisakhi | A major festival in India, especially in Punjab, celebrating the harvest season and the founding of the Khalsa. |
April 15 | World Art Day | Promotes the role of art in society and encourages the creative spirit across cultures. |
April 17 | World Hemophilia Day | Raises awareness of hemophilia and other bleeding disorders and promotes access to proper care. |
April 18 | World Heritage Day | Celebrates cultural heritage and aims to preserve historic sites and monuments around the world. |
April 18 | World Liver Day | Raises awareness about liver diseases, their prevention, and healthy liver practices. |
April 19 | World Liver Day | Raises awareness about liver health and the importance of early diagnosis and prevention of liver diseases. |
April 20 | Chinese Language Day | Celebrates the history, culture, and significance of the Chinese language, emphasizing linguistic diversity. |
April 21 | Secretaries’ Day | Honors the contributions of secretaries and administrative assistants to organizations. |
April 21 | National Civil Services Day (India) | Commemorates the establishment of the Indian Civil Services and highlights the importance of civil servants in governance. |
April 22 | Earth Day | A day to promote environmental protection, sustainability, and climate action. |
April 23 | World Book Day | Celebrates literature, authors, and promotes reading and education. |
April 23 | World Book and Copyright Day | Focuses on the importance of intellectual property and the value of books and their content. |
April 24 | World Lab Animals Day | A day to raise awareness about the treatment of animals used in research and to promote animal welfare. |
April 24 | National Panchayati Raj Day (India) | Commemorates the enactment of the Panchayati Raj Act, empowering local self-governance in India. |
April 25 | World Malaria Day | Focuses on malaria prevention, treatment, and the ongoing battle to reduce malaria-related deaths. |
April 26 | World Intellectual Property Day | Celebrates the role of intellectual property in fostering innovation and creativity. |
April 28 | World Day for Safety and Health at Work | Promotes the importance of workplace safety and health, advocating for safe working conditions worldwide. |
April 29 | International Dance Day | Celebrates dance as a universal language of movement and expression, highlighting its cultural significance. |
April 30 | Ayushman Bharat Diwas (India) | Marks the anniversary of the launch of the Ayushman Bharat Scheme, which provides health coverage to millions in India. |
April 30 | International Jazz Day | Celebrates the cultural significance of jazz music and its role in promoting peace and understanding across the globe. |
